Maglev Train

The Maglev train is the fastest train in the world connects the Shanghai Pudong International Airport with Shanghai Pudong New Area with 19 miles and taking 8 minutes.

Origin: Pudong Airport

Destination: Longyang Rd.Metro Station

Operating Hours: Pudong Airport--Longyang Road 7:02-21:42

Longyang Road--Pudong Airport: 6:45-21:40

Interval/min 15mins before 7:02PM, 20mins after 7:02PM

Fare/RMB Single Trip: 50, Round Trip: 80

Maximum speed 300 km/h (7:02-8:47、11:02-14:47、17:02-21:42)

430 km/h(9:02-10:47、15:02-16:47)

Shanghai Taxi Rates

Comprehensive Price: price = base fare RMB 14 (first three kilometers) + RMB 2.4 for every succeeding km within 10 km and RMB 3.6 for every succeeding km after 10 km.

Night taxi service (from daily 23:00 to the next 05:00 ): price = base fare RMB 17 + RMB 3.1 for every succeeding km within 10 km and RMB 4.1 for every succeeding km after 10 km.

8. Currency Exchange/Credit Cards/Banks

Chinese Currency is called the China Yuan (RMB). Chinese paper money usually comes in: 1yuan, 5 yuan, 10 yuan, 20 yuan, 50 yuan and 100 yuan. Chinese currency can be exchanged at banks, hotels and Pudong Airport.

Exchange rates are subject to market fluctuations. As of 28 September 2015, One U.S. Dollar is approximately RMB 6.37.

Credit cards (Visa, American Express, Diner’s Club, MasterCard and JCB) are accepted at hotels, department stores, and most shops and restaurants. If your credit card does not have a photo please be sure to carry with you a photo ID.

Banking Hours: all banks are open only on weekdays 09:00 am – 05:00 pm

Electricity

The electric current in China is 220V, 50/Hz, and the below plugs are usually used. If your appliances plug has a different shape, you may need a plug adapter.
